Output bb69cb2fbb24b807e0d0f2a91c377f3274da2865345f7ae141388357ddaf3304:31

value
42481
script pubkey
OP_0 OP_PUSHBYTES_20 d085d86ab5d1faae8602382db7c13b742678ed75
address
bc1q6zzas64468a2apsz8qkm0sfmwsn83mt48a5ta7
transaction
bb69cb2fbb24b807e0d0f2a91c377f3274da2865345f7ae141388357ddaf3304
confirmations
36922
spent
true